    Rear-End Collisions

    Rear-end collisions involving large trucks occur when the truckdriver fails to stop in time and collides with the back of the vehicle in front of the truck in the lane. These accidents are often caused by tailgating, distracted driving, speeding, or brake failure. Because of the size and weight of commercial trucks, even low speed rear-end collisions can result in catastrophic injuries and extensive property damage to the vehicle hit.

    Car accident – $500,000 Jury Verdict

    Our client suffered a broken neck after being rear-ended by a drug user in a stolen car. The owner of the car’s insurance company denied they were responsible for our client’s permanent and life changing injuries. We believed differently. The owner had let that person use the car with full knowledge that they were a user of crack cocaine. Our attorneys argued at trial that a reasonable person could foresee that a drug user would steal the car and injure someone else. The jury agreed with us and apportioned fault to the car’s owner. The jury included over $500,000 in damages for our client. Now our client’s medical expenses are paid and they’ve obtained justice.
